最近买了几块Orange Pi lite2,是学校一个小项目,要求局域网内通信,在别人推荐下,第一次使用这个板子,全志H6芯片,板载WiFi、蓝牙,感觉还不错,顺便记录下遇到的坑,分享给大家。 香橙派Orange Pi Lite 2是一款开源的单板电脑,新一代的arm开发板,它可以运行Android7.0、Ubuntu、Debian等操作系统,兼容树莓派。香橙派Orange Pi Lite
转载
2023-11-16 14:18:42
247阅读
## 介绍香橙派与UART
香橙派(Orange Pi)是一款功能强大、性价比高的单板计算机。它可以用于多种应用,如物联网、机器人和各种嵌入式系统开发。在这些应用中,串口通信(UART)是一项重要的技术,用于不同设备间的数据交换。
UART(通用异步收发传输器)是一个串行通信协议,常用于微控制器和计算机之间的数据传输。香橙派支持使用Python进行编程操作UART,提高了开发的灵活性与便捷性。
原创
2024-09-01 04:44:15
631阅读
详细说明树莓派/香橙派开启WIFI/热点
准备工作:一、VNC登录香橙派1、先用Putty ssh远程登录香橙派2、开启VNC3、VNC登录二、启用Wifi网卡1、先进行USB无线网卡加载测试2、然后进行WIFI连接测试(这一步仅仅是为了测试USB是否可以正常工作 可以跳过)3、断开上一步的Wifi网络连接三、将Wifi网卡配置为热点模式1、使用create_ap脚本(linux
转载
2023-08-11 09:03:56
924阅读
点赞
1评论
1.time 模块 --- 时间获取和转换1)time.ctime( ) 时间的字符串2)time.time( ) 返回当前时间的时间戳3)time.sleep( ) 延时多少秒2.math 可以调用pi常用函数3.import os1)Python os 模块提供了一个统一的操作系统接口函数, 这些接口函数通常是平台指定的,os 模块能
转载
2024-03-31 11:05:52
74阅读
下载的是ubuntu-server系统。用的是一台十几年前的笔记本,DELL M6300,OS为win7 32,首先安装了SDFormatter(格式化SD卡)【格式化的时候记得:选项设置——逻辑大小调整:ON】然后是:Win32DiskImager.exe,烧录工具,官网都有下载的。不多说。整好系统,把卡插到Zero,通电,插上网线。开机十秒的时间就好了。IP地址是DHCP的,所以在路由器里面去
转载
2023-07-06 15:40:11
710阅读
一、什么是树莓派
树莓派(Raspberry Pi)是由Raspberry Pi(中文名为“树莓派”,简写为RPi,(或者RasPi / RPI) 是为学习计算机编程教育而设计),只有信用卡大小的微型电脑,其系统基于Linux。我们可以将树莓派连接电视、显示器、键盘鼠标等设备使用。
树莓派能替代日常桌面计算机的多种用途,包括文字处理、电子表格、媒体中心甚至是游戏。并
转载
2023-11-30 12:18:37
413阅读
## python香橙派快速入门指南
欢迎来到“python香橙派”项目的世界!如果你是一名刚入行的小白,别担心,我将一步一步教会你如何使用 Python 在香橙派(Orange Pi)上进行开发。整个流程可以分为以下几个步骤:
| 步骤 | 内容 | 预计时间 |
|------|-------------------|----------|
| 1 | 准备
原创
2024-08-18 04:05:41
309阅读
上一期跟大家分享了如何下载和安装操作系统,这一期将跟大家分享操作系统的初始化。在准备好操作系统后,将含有操作系统的TF卡插入卡槽,准备给香橙派通电。香橙派的操作有两种方式,一种和普通电脑一样,通过板载的HDMI接口连接显示器,再通过USB接口连接键盘和鼠标进行操作。另一种是通过SSH协议利用网络或者串口对香橙派进行操作,第一种方法使用比较简单,所以这里介绍一下第二种方法。由于操作系统没有进行网络设
转载
2023-11-28 13:14:21
542阅读
今天群里面的朋友搭建Web,参照的很多网站的教程,结果都说是错误的,现在自己的Web访问不了了,可能他的路径是错误的,但是不管怎样,我现在教大家怎么配置Nginx.如果本地web没有公网Ip,请用Ngrok穿透.
Apache
更新系统,这是安装软件前的良好习惯.#更新软件列表。
sudo apt-get update
#更新软件。
su
转载
2024-05-02 14:31:51
189阅读
一、下载编译环境首先是从github拉去orange-pi的编译环境,百度网盘下载的比较旧,解压完也需要重新拉取 这里为了加速,在github账号里面,fork一下官网的仓库,然后在gitee里面导入一下,之后就可以在gitee里面下载了git clone https://gitee.com/maple-feather/orangepi-build.git 可以看到速度相对于github,还是可以
转载
2023-09-23 01:04:05
611阅读
# 香橙派 Python 灯项目指南
## 项目概述
在这个项目中,我们将利用香橙派(Orange Pi)和Python创建一个简单的LED灯控制系统。通过使用GPIO接口,我们可以编写代码来控制灯的开关。这不仅是一个有趣的项目,也是学习硬件编程的良好起点。以下是这个项目的整体流程和步骤。
## 项目流程
| 步骤 | 描述 |
|---
# 香橙派 Python GPIO科普
香橙派是一种基于ARM Cortex-A8的开源硬件平台,具有丰富的GPIO(通用输入输出)接口,使其成为一个非常适合用于物联网和嵌入式系统开发的工具。Python是一种简单易学的编程语言,结合Python和香橙派的GPIO,可以让开发者快速实现各种项目。
## GPIO介绍
GPIO是通用输入输出,可以用来连接各种外部设备,如传感器、LED等。在香橙
原创
2024-06-07 05:51:48
511阅读
背景之前一直使用树莓派做一些物联网开发的小项目。然而,今年,由于芯片的涨价,树莓派4B裸板要卖到700人民币,连上一代的树莓派3B也要搭配套装一起买,价格也大多到了5、600人民币。更离谱的是连树莓派zero都要卖到200元。 于是看了一圈,发现有已国产开发板,香橙派(OrangePi)价格上算合理。这个品牌的开发板都使用全志的芯片,看了一下尺寸、功能和价格,我选了Orange Pi Zero2,
转载
2023-08-11 09:04:09
698阅读
1.WiringPi串口示例程序报错:No Such File or directory香橙派虽然是一款性价比很高的Linux开发板,但是和树莓派相比,其开发文档、社区资源都相对匮乏,而且很多库都是从树莓派那移植过来的,比如控制IO的库:WiringPi,而这往往会导致一些错误的发生,比如这个让我头痛的串口错误: 分析错误的原因,不难发现问题出在/dev/ttyAMA0这,ls /dev
转载
2023-11-06 16:19:48
741阅读
本方案的初衷:UU加速盒价格昂贵,恰巧官方发布了Openwrt插件,于是想通过教程让更多人利用自己手里的开发板作为盒子使用,一举两得。之前网上没有相关教程,zero2也没有Openwrt固件,于是就写了这篇文章。P.S.本方案适用于单口树莓派以及其他单口香橙派。至于为什么没有多接口,主要是因为docker在配置多网口开发板时虚拟网卡写法与单口不同。详情查看docker官网。本方法基于以下操作:1、
转载
2024-04-16 13:58:50
569阅读
# 如何在香橙派上使用Python进行串口通信
在嵌入式系统和物联网应用中,串口通信是一项关键技能。对于入门级开发者来说,掌握如何在香橙派上使用Python进行串口通信是非常重要的。本文将帮助你逐步了解整个过程,并提供必要的代码和详细注释。
## 文章结构
1. 流程概述
2. 环境准备
3. 安装所需库
4. 编写串口通信代码
5. 测试与调试
6. 总结与后续学习
## 流程概述
以
# 在香橙派上跑 Python 的路线图
香橙派是一款广受欢迎的单板计算机,适合学习和实践编程、物联网等项目。对于刚入行的小白来说,能够在香橙派上运行 Python 程序将是一个愉快而有意义的体验。本篇文章将详细介绍在香橙派上运行 Python 的步骤,并提供示例代码以供参考。
## 整体流程
在香橙派上运行 Python 通常分为几个步骤。以下是整个过程的简要概述:
| 步骤 | 描述
原创
2024-09-30 03:14:11
277阅读
### 使用 Python 控制香橙派 GPIO 的指南
香橙派(Orange Pi)作为一款优秀的单板计算机,广泛应用于物联网和嵌入式项目中。本文将引导您通过 Python 编程来控制香橙派的 GPIO(通用输入输出)引脚,帮助您入门这一领域。
#### 整体流程概览
首先,我们来看看整个开发流程,分为五个主要步骤:
| 步骤 | 描述 |
前言此篇文章面向对象:刚刚接触树莓派的小白,推荐的新手系统,简单易懂,一看就会,10分钟内搞定,快速爽上流,让刚拿到树莓派的你快速开启你的学习(受苦 )之旅shell1、准备工做树莓派3(略有磨损 )树莓派4(崭新出厂 )(二选一)显示器(树莓派3HDIM)(树莓派4Mico HDIM)至少16GBTF卡(推荐32GB或者更高)TF卡读卡器服务器桌面端软件SDFormatter(TF卡格式化)网络
目录引脚图下载 orangepi-build校验压缩包解压 orangepi-build.tar.gz同步源码编译内核更换linux-rk3399-legacy.config文件运行 build.sh选择 Kernel package选择开发板的型号(orangepi4)选择"< Exit >"关闭内核源码的更新功能更改内核源码禁用 spi1打开 uart4重装开发板内核上传新的内核卸
转载
2024-06-12 09:47:46
278阅读